IC697BEM721 GE Fanuc Series 90-70 I/O Link Interface Module

IC697BEM721 GE Fanuc Series 90-70 I/O Link Interface Module

IC697BEM721 is a Bus Receiver Module (BRM) manufactured by GE Fanuc Emerson and is part of the Series 90-70 Programmable Logic Controller system.

Product parameters

Communication specifications: Supports IC66* remote I/O bus protocol, physical interface is RS-422/485 differential signal, equipped with 15-pin bus port (for bus connection) + 9-pin handheld monitoring port (for local debugging).

Transmission performance: The transmission rate is adjustable in three Settings: 38.4Kbaud, 76.8Kbaud, and 153.6Kbaud. Maximum bus distance: 2,275 meters (7,500 feet) at 38.4Kbaud, 1,365 meters (4,500 feet) at 76.8Kbaud, and 605 meters (2,000 feet) at 153.6Kbaud.

I/O capacity: Supports up to 30 remote I/O sub-stations, and 10 to 20 sub-stations when fully loaded. A single module can handle up to 1024 discrete I/O points or 64 analog I/O points, and a single remote substation supports up to 128-byte input + 128-byte output.

Power supply and power consumption: Powered by the Series 90-70 rack backplane bus (DC 5V), the typical backplane current value is 1.2A, and no independent external power supply is required.

Physics and Environment: Compatible with Series 90-70 series 32mm standard racks, operating temperature 0°C to 60°C, storage temperature -40°C to +85°C, protection grade IP20, electrical isolation between bus side and backplane bus (500V DC).

Function

Remote I/O expansion: As a "data transmission bridge" between the main PLC and the remote I/O module, it scans the discrete/analog I/O data on the remote rack in real time and uploads it to the main CPU. At the same time, it issues the master station control instructions to the remote actuator, solving the problem of insufficient local I/O points or scattered devices.

Bus topology adaptation: Supports daisy-chain wiring, allowing a single shielded cable to be connected in series with multiple remote sub-stations, significantly simplifying on-site wiring, reducing cable costs and construction difficulty.

Data reliability guarantee: Built-in parity check and data frame error detection functions, automatically triggering a retry mechanism when transmission anomalies occur. It is equipped with fault diagnosis pins and can be linked to external alarm devices.

Status visualization and diagnosis: Intuitively feedback the working status of the module through LED indicator lights; Supports system-level diagnosis, and fault codes can be read through PLC programming software, facilitating quick problem identification.

Seamless system compatibility: Fully compatible with all Series 90-70 cpus and 5/10/15 slot racks, and compatible with remote I/O modules of the same series. No additional driver adaptation is required during configuration.

Application scenarios

Distributed control of industrial production lines: In production lines of industries such as automobiles, electronics, and building materials, sensors and actuators scattered in different areas of the workshop are connected through remote I/O racks and centrally controlled by the main PLC to achieve multi-area collaborative operations.

Long-distance I/O access in process industries: In large-scale facilities in the chemical, metallurgical, and power industries, due to the wide distribution of equipment, this module can be used to expand remote I/O sub-stations, avoiding signal attenuation and cost waste caused by long-distance laying of I/O cables.

Old system I/O expansion and upgrade: When the existing Series 90-70 control system needs to increase the number of I/O points due to capacity improvement and process upgrading, there is no need to replace the main CPU. Only by expanding the remote rack through this module can the original system resources be reused and the upgrade cost be reduced.

Large-scale equipment zonal control: In large-scale equipment such as machine tools, warehousing and logistics systems, and production line conveyor lines, remote I/O sub-stations are configured according to functional zones. Through modules, the master station can precisely control and collect data from each zonal equipment.
